Over the Limit

Friday, January 11, 2019, 7:30 p.m., Dryden Theatre

(Marta Prus, Poland/Germany/Finland/France 2017, 74 min., DCP, Russian w/subtitles)

Rochester Premiere. A nail-biting behind-the-scenes drama about the intense physical and mental labor put into a sport that thrives on its beautiful aesthetics. Elite rhythmic gymnast Margarita Mamun has reached a crucial moment in her career. She’s soon to retire (at age 20), but has one final goal set out for her: winning Olympic gold. This documentary leading up to the 2016 summer games in Brazil observes the overwhelming physical preparation that goes into competing at the international level, as well as the psychological and emotional abuse that purports to toughen her up for the final stage in her career.
